How much does it cost to rent a home in Cottage City?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cottage City 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,650 | $1,600 | $4,000 |
Cottage City 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,150 | $2,000 | $3,700 |
Cottage City 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,980 | $3,000 | $5,700 |
Cottage City 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,500 | $3,500 | $3,500 |
Cottage City 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$7,800 | $7,800 | $7,800 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cottage City
What type of rentals are currently available in Cottage City?
There are currently 183 Apartments for Rent in Cottage City, MD with pricing that ranges from $900 to $4,694. There are also 53 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Cottage City ranging from $680 to $7,800.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Cottage City?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Cottage City ranges from $680 to $7,800 with an average monthly rent of $3,928.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Cottage City?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Cottage City range from $1,508 to $3,539,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,000 to $3,700.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,000 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,399.
